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Edmonton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Edmonton with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Edmonton is at Ekota Manor Affordable listed at $1,000.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Edmonton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Edmonton is $1,826.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Edmonton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Edmonton is a 1,930 square feet unit starting from $5,000 at Falcon Towers.

What is the average size for Edmonton 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Edmonton is currently 970 sq ft.
